Dental care costs shift based on the complexity of your treatment and the materials required. A simple cleaning is far more affordable than a crown, bridge, or dental implant, which involve more time and specialized labs. Insurance coverage also plays a big role in your final out-of-pocket expense, as does the condition of your oral health when you first walk through the door.
Searching for a dentist near you is the first step in maintaining a healthy smile. A local office provides a convenient way to get regular exams, cleanings, and diagnostic X-rays. Having a regular dentist helps you track changes in your oral health over time and prevents small problems from becoming painful or expensive later.
